What to expect from Tap Tap Loot

In Tap Tap Loot, you progress with every click and keystroke. You play as your own cat hero who embarks on an adventure of epic proportions. Your hero will be extremely weak in the beginning, but the more you type and click, the more your characters grow.

No two heroes are the same, and you can choose from 200 unique items. There are different classes and weapons to utilise if you want to do that. You’re free to decide how your character plays and develops.

You’ll come across different enemies spread across six unique biomes. You can also invite up to three others for four-player co-op and share the spoils. If you’re still unsure about the game, you can try the free demo on Steam.
